THE BATTERIES (fig. 17—page 9 & fig. 32)
3.1 2 batteries are provided which can be connected in parallel with the supplied “Y”
connector. (see fig 17– page 9)
3.2 One battery will power 3 to 5 hours sailing depending on load and usage.
3.3 Never allow the batteries to go dead flat. Charge batteries one at a time, leave them
overnight on the trickle charger supplied. (fig 33)
3.4 Spray the battery plugs with corrosion guard.

THE HELM WINCH (fig 23)
4.1 The helm winch has limit switches which limit
the travel of the tillers.
4.2 There is a clutch which disengages the steering
line drum from the servo motor allowing for manual
steering. To engage the servo assist steering it is
easiest to engage the clutch by pushing the manual
joystick hard over to one side and run the winch
hard over the same way, then screw in the drum to
engage the clutch.
